Output 6152cd3be11f6f584cc31ab6b44c0c8aa01992bcbee52600320577abf5267fed:3

value
3700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ae7421f11873ab4e5b6a34df66f911aeca202c8 OP_EQUAL
address
35bsLi2DafjC2LtRS3t1UYauyHd45T86se
transaction
6152cd3be11f6f584cc31ab6b44c0c8aa01992bcbee52600320577abf5267fed
spent
true